Bernina Videos

Did you know that TQS has over 40 instructional videos created by Bernina for our member's viewing pleasure?  Instructors Nina McVeigh and Susan Beck take you through everything from Decorative Stitch Applique to Crazy Patchwork Made Easy to Machine Embroidered Applique.  The TQS Bernina library has been growing with creativity for more than three years, is it time for you to take a peek?

Lace Museum

If you can't make it to Washington D.C. to see the Behind the Scenes Lace/Quilt Tours mentioned in the January 19th Newsletter, maybe you can visit the Lace Museum and Guild in Sunnyvale, California.  It is one of only two museums in the United States dedicated solely to the art of making lace.  A new exhibition will be opening soon.
